    Additional file 4: of Protein kinase C inhibitor Gรถ6976 but not Gรถ6983 induces the reversion of E- to N-cadherin switch and metastatic phenotype in melanoma: identification of the role of protein kinase D1

    No full text
    PKD1 knockdown induces the expression of E-cadherin and inhibits the expression of N-cadherin in M4T2 metastatic melanoma cells. M4T2 cells were transfected or not with either specific PKD1-targeting (siPKD1) or control non-targeting (siControl) siRNAs according to the manufacturer protocol (Santa Cruz Biotechnology, sc-36245 and sc-37007, respectively). Three days after transfection, these cells were analyzed by western blot for PKD1, E-cadherin, N-cadherin and actin expression. (PPTX 102 kb

    Additional file 2: of Protein kinase C inhibitor Gö6976 but not Gö6983 induces the reversion of E- to N-cadherin switch and metastatic phenotype in melanoma: identification of the role of protein kinase D1

    No full text
    Effect of Gö6976 on the expression of E- and N-cadherins and the anchorage-independent growth in I5 primary melanoma cell line. A. I5 primary melanoma cells were seeded in 6-well plates at the density of 50,000 cells per well. After three days of culture, cells were treated with 1 μM Gö6976, 1 μM Gö6983 or DMSO for 24 h. Cells were then lysed and proteins analyzed by western blot using anti-E-cadherin, anti-N-cadherin or anti-actin antibodies. T1 melanoma cells were used as positive control for E-cadherin expression. B. I5 primary melanoma cells were seeded in methylcellulose (1000 cells per plate) containing 1 μM Gö6976 or 1 μM Gö6983. The colonies were counted after 18 days of culture. (PPTX 135 kb

    Additional file 3: of Protein kinase C inhibitor Gö6976 but not Gö6983 induces the reversion of E- to N-cadherin switch and metastatic phenotype in melanoma: identification of the role of protein kinase D1

    No full text
    Correlation between PKD1 expression and mesenchymal features in primary (T1 and I5) and metastatic (G1, M2 and M4T2) melanoma cells. The relationship between PKD1 expression and mesenchymal features in melanoma cells was estimated using Pearson’s correlation analysis applied on the data from western blot, MTT, methylcellulose and wound healing assays that are presented in Figs. 1, 6 and 7a.
